OBJECTIVE: BRCA1/2 gene mutation which is prevalent in the Ashkenazi Jewish population is associated with an increased risk for developing breast cancer and ovarian cancer. Few recent studies, have established a commonly accepted belief suggesting that BRCA mutations are associated with low ovarian reserve and poor response to ovarian stimulation, as well as early menopause. We aimed to evaluate a possible association between carriage of BRCA1/2 mutations and low ovarian reserve, as demonstrated by ART performance of BRCA mutation carriers. DESIGN: Multicenter retrospective study including BRCA mutation carriers who underwent COH for IVF between 2000 and 2012. Healthy and cancer patients were compared with controls. MATERIALS AND METHODS: The study group was divided into two sub-groups: (1) BRCA positive breast cancer patients, undergoing fertility preservation prior to chemotherapy, were compared with breast cancer patients whose BRCA mutation status was negative or unknown. (2) Healthy BRCA carriers, undergoing fertility treatment or IVF for PGD, were compared with male factor infertility patients and non-BRCA PGD patients. Patient’s age, cancer status, BRCA mutation status, stimulation data and ART outcomes were extracted from patients’ medical records. When more than one IVF cycle was recorded per patient, only the most favorable cycle (maximal oocytes yield) was included in analysis. Low response to COH was defined as retrieval of four or fewer oocytes per cycle. RESULTS: Fifty seven BRCA mutation carriers underwent 124 IVF cycles and 130 controls underwent 233 IVF cycles. A total of 187 best performed cycles were compared. Patients’ age, duration of stimulation and peak E2 levels were comparable between carriers and controls. Number of oocytes retrieved (15.00 8.06 vs. 14 8.24, p1⁄40.44), number of 2PN embryos (9.61 5.91 vs. 8.17 5.55, p1⁄40.077) and low response rate (8.77% versus 8.46%, p1⁄41) were also not significantly different. An age-stratified ( 37 years old) analysis indicated similar oocytes yield in each carriers subgroups and their corresponding age matched control subgroup. CONCLUSION: BRCA mutation carriers constitute a unique population of women who frequently utilize ART treatments, whether for fertility preservation prior to chemotherapy or for PGD. Contrary to previous publications described, our results provide reassuring data and confirm normal IVF performance among BRCA mutation carriers.
